Bill pays your for your housing based on the BAH rate for the area you are attending school. http://www.benefits.va.gov/GIBILL/resources/benefi...So, why can't you purchase a duplex, triplex or fourplex as your primary residence (qualifying based on the BAH you will receive), live in one unit while renting the others (cash flow in your pocket), then finish college, move to your job location, rent out the unit you lived in and start your investing adventure all over again?
